Great Outdoors "Horizon" Gas GrillsModels effected:These are Great Outdoors Gas Grills (Horizon Model) with model number GH450SBP and GH450XBP. Problem: Certain wind conditions blowing at these grills can cause overheating or flashbacks under the control panel. Flames could damage the hose that supplies gas to the burner, causing an uncontrolled flame. Also, flames could come in contact with user's hands, resulting in burns. How to tell if you grill is effected: The model number is on the CSA approval sticker on the back of the front panel. Grills with a fluorescent label on the carton reading "Contains Safety Enhancement" are not included in the recall. Period the grill was available for: February 2003 through June 2003 Solution: Contact CFM corp to receive a customer installable safety retrofit kit. Grill Express by CTC - 60 Second Grill ExpressModels effected:Model G250 Problem: The heating element in the grill's base can become dislodged, melting the grill's plastic base. How to tell if you grill is effected: This recall involves grills, model number G250, with the date codes numbering between 9437 and 9448 located just above a silver foil label on the underside of the grill, Visit U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ission for Data sheet on how to identify a faulty grill Period the grill was available for: October 1994 to January 1995 Solution: Discard Grill, Company has gone out of business Contact: More information: U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ission warning |

Grillmaster Gas Grills made by SunbeamModels effected:The model numbers of the grills are: 56GR8, 560R8, 562D1, 562D9, GC548517, GG546517, GS544417, GS544717, GS546517, GG546537 and GG547517. Problem: The side burner's propane gas hose can twist up toward the aluminum casting of the grill, causing overheating and melting of the hose. Gas leakage or a fire could result from the hose damage. How to tell if you grill is effected: The complete model numbers can be found on the identification label on the back of the grill, and on the assembly instructions and parts list. Period the grill was available for: 1996 through July 1998 Solution: Contact Sunbeam for a free retrofit kit Contact: Call Sunbeam toll-free at (800) 200-2300 More information: U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ission warning |
